Computer >> 컴퓨터 >  >> 문제 해결 >> Windows 오류

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

원격 프로시저 호출은 프로그램이 네트워크 세부 정보에 빠지지 않고 네트워크의 다른 컴퓨터에 있는 프로그램에서 서비스를 요청하는 데 사용하는 프로토콜입니다. RPC는 클라이언트-서버 모델을 사용합니다. 서비스 제공자가 서버인 동안 요청하는 프로그램은 클라이언트로 간주됩니다. RPC는 원격 프로시저의 결과가 반환될 때까지 프로그램을 일시 중단해야 하는 동기식 프로세스입니다.

때로는 프로그램이 일시 중단되지 않고 컴퓨터에서 높은 CPU 및 디스크 사용량을 유발할 때 발생합니다. Windows Update, OneDrive 또는 Dropbox 등과 같이 RPC를 사용하는 많은 서비스가 있습니다. 이러한 서비스를 살펴보고 어떤 프로세스가 문제를 일으키는지 확인할 수 있습니다.

해결 방법 1:OneDrive 비활성화

OneDrive는 많은 경우에 높은 CPU 사용량을 유발하는 것으로 알려져 있습니다. 클라우드 서버와 지속적으로 동기화되며 구성이 제대로 이루어지지 않으면 많은 디스크 사용량이 발생합니다. OneDrive를 올바르게 비활성화하고 문제가 계속 지속되는지 확인할 수 있습니다. 이 방법이 효과가 없으면 언제든지 변경 사항을 되돌릴 수 있습니다.

  1. Windows + R 누르기 버튼을 눌러 실행 애플리케이션을 시작합니다. '제어판 입력 "를 입력하고 Enter 키를 누릅니다.
  2. 제어판에서 "프로그램 제거를 클릭합니다. " 프로그램 및 기능 제목 아래에 있습니다.
  3. 이제 Windows는 사용자 앞에 설치된 모든 프로그램을 나열합니다. OneDrive를 찾을 때까지 탐색합니다. . 오른쪽 클릭 그것을 선택하고 제거 .

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 제거되면 컴퓨터를 다시 시작하고 CPU 사용량이 수정되었는지 확인하십시오.

프로그램 목록에 OneDrive가 없으면 비활성화할 수 있습니다.

  1. OneDrive가 활성화되어 있으면 OneDrive를 볼 수 있습니다. 작업 표시줄에 있는 아이콘 화면 오른쪽 상단에. 마우스 오른쪽 버튼으로 클릭 설정을 선택합니다. .

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 설정 탭으로 이동합니다. 모든 상자를 선택 취소 일반의 소제목으로 존재 .

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 이제 자동 저장 탭으로 이동합니다. . 여기 문서 및 그림의 부제목 아래에서 선택합니다. “이 PC만 사진 카테고리에 대한 ” 옵션 및 문서 .

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 이제 계정 탭으로 이동합니다. 폴더 선택을 클릭합니다. 창 하단에 표시됩니다.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. OneDrive와 동기화된 폴더 목록이 포함된 새 창이 나타납니다. 이제 모든 상자를 선택 취소하세요. 폴더를 나타냅니다. 이제 설정 변경 사항을 저장하고 종료합니다.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 이제 OneDrive 설정을 다시 열고 계정 탭으로 이동합니다. 상단에 표시됩니다.
  2. 이 PC 연결 해제를 클릭합니다. OneDrive의 소제목 아래에 있습니다. 변경 사항을 저장하고 설정을 종료합니다.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 이제 파일 탐색기를 엽니다. , OneDrive를 마우스 오른쪽 버튼으로 클릭 아이콘이 왼쪽 탐색 창에 표시되고 속성을 클릭합니다. .
  2. 일반 탭에서 '숨김' 확인란 선택 속성의 소제목 아래에 있습니다. 확인을 클릭하여 변경 사항을 저장하고 종료합니다. 그러면 파일 탐색기에서 OneDrive가 숨겨집니다.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 이제 OneDrive 아이콘을 마우스 오른쪽 버튼으로 클릭합니다. 화면 오른쪽 하단에 표시하고 종료를 클릭합니다. . OneDrive가 종료됩니다.

이제 컴퓨터를 다시 시작하고 디스크/CPU 사용량이 고정되어 있는지 확인하십시오.

해결 방법 2:Windows 업데이트 비활성화

Windows는 업데이트를 검색할 때도 RPC 프로토콜을 사용합니다. PC에 업데이트가 설치된 경우에도 Windows는 다운로드할 수 있는 추가 업데이트를 계속 검색합니다. 이것은 때때로 루프에서 계속 진행되어 높은 CPU/디스크 사용량을 소모할 수 있습니다. Windows 업데이트를 비활성화하고 문제가 여전히 지속되는지 확인할 수 있습니다.

  1. Windows + S를 눌러 검색 창을 실행합니다. 'Windows 업데이트 입력 "를 입력하고 나오는 결과를 엽니다.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. '업데이트 설정 제목 아래 ", 고급 옵션을 선택합니다.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 페이지 하단으로 스크롤합니다. 여기에 "업데이트 제공 방법 선택 옵션이 있습니다. ". 클릭하세요.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 이제 업데이트를 다운로드할 위치에 대한 옵션으로 구성된 새 창이 나타납니다. 컴퓨터가 인터넷에 연결되어 있을 때 업데이트를 계속 검색하므로 이 설정은 주로 RPC 프로토콜을 담당합니다. 비활성화 그리고 이전 창으로 돌아갑니다.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. "업데이트 일시 중지 활성화 ". 이제 컴퓨터를 다시 시작하고 CPU/디스크 사용량이 좋아졌는지 확인하십시오. 컴퓨터에 시간이 없으면 약 30분 정도 기다렸다가 나아지는지 확인하십시오. 그렇지 않은 경우 아래의 더 많은 방법을 참조하세요.

Windows 업데이트가 여전히 제대로 종료되지 않고 이것이 범인이라고 생각되면 다시 켜고 싶을 때까지 서비스를 영구적으로 비활성화할 수 있습니다. 이미 다운로드한 업데이트 파일도 삭제합니다.

  1. Windows + R을 눌러 애플리케이션 실행을 불러옵니다. 대화 상자에 '서비스를 입력합니다. msc ". 그러면 컴퓨터에서 실행 중인 모든 서비스가 표시됩니다.
  2. "Windows 업데이트 서비스라는 서비스를 찾을 때까지 목록을 탐색합니다. ". 서비스를 마우스 오른쪽 버튼으로 클릭하고 속성을 선택합니다. .

<강한> 수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 중지를 클릭합니다. 서비스 상태의 소제목 아래에 있습니다. 이제 Windows 업데이트 서비스가 중지되었으며 계속 진행할 수 있습니다.

이제 Windows Update 디렉토리로 이동하여 이미 존재하는 모든 업데이트된 파일을 삭제합니다. 파일 탐색기나 내 컴퓨터를 열고 단계를 따르세요.

  1. 아래에 기재된 주소로 이동합니다. 또한 Run 애플리케이션을 실행하고 주소를 복사하여 붙여넣기하여 직접 연결할 수도 있습니다.

C:\Windows\SoftwareDistribution

  1. 소프트웨어 배포 내의 모든 항목 삭제 폴더를 잘라서 다른 위치에 다시 붙여넣을 수도 있습니다.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

해결책 3:배포 이미지 서비스 및 관리 사용

DISM은 운영 체제를 서비스하는 데 사용되는 명령줄 도구입니다. 이 명령을 실행할 수 있으며 불일치가 있으면 수정됩니다.

참고: 이 솔루션을 실행하려면 Windows 업데이트가 필요합니다. Windows 업데이트가 손상되었거나 작동하지 않는 경우 이전 복원 지점에서 OS 복원을 고려할 수 있습니다.

  1. Windows + S를 눌러 검색 창을 실행합니다. 대화 상자에 "명령 프롬프트"를 입력하고 결과를 마우스 오른쪽 버튼으로 클릭한 다음 "관리자 권한으로 실행"을 선택합니다.
  2. 명령 프롬프트에서 다음 명령을 실행합니다.

DISM.exe /온라인 /Cleanup-image /Restorehealth

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 프로세스는 시간이 걸리므로 인내심을 갖고 프로세스를 완료하십시오. 이제 다음 명령을 실행합니다.

sfc /scannow

  1. 두 명령을 모두 실행한 후 컴퓨터를 재부팅하고 문제가 해결되었는지 확인합니다.

해결책 4:타사 애플리케이션 확인

Google Chrome, Dropbox, Xbox 등과 같은 응용 프로그램에서 디스크 사용에 문제가 발생한다는 보고가 많이 있습니다. 각 컴퓨터 구성이 다르기 때문에 어떤 응용 프로그램이 문제를 일으키는지 정확히 진단할 수 없습니다.

교육적으로 추측하고 이러한 각 응용 프로그램을 적절하게 비활성화하고 CPU/디스크 사용량을 확인하십시오. 동기화를 위해 자주 인터넷에 액세스해야 하는 응용 프로그램에 더 많은 우선 순위를 부여합니다. 다음은 몇 가지 응용 프로그램과 수정 사항입니다.

  • Google 크롬이 있는 경우 다시 설치하세요.
  • Dropbox를 적절하게 비활성화하고 시작 시 애플리케이션이 실행되지 않도록 합니다.
  • Xbox 애플리케이션을 끕니다.

해결 방법 5:Windows Defender 비활성화

많은 사용자가 Windows Defender가 문제를 일으키고 있다고 보고했습니다. 응용 프로그램은 바이러스 정의를 계속 검색했고 RPC 프로토콜을 실행하여 CPU 사용량을 높였습니다. 바이러스 백신 유틸리티를 비활성화하고 문제가 여전히 지속되는지 확인할 수 있습니다.

  1. ⊞ Win + R 버튼을 누르고 대화 상자에 "gpedit.를 입력합니다. msc ".
  2. 로컬 그룹 정책 편집자 앞으로 올 것이다. 컴퓨터 구성을 클릭합니다. 탭을 클릭하고 관리 템플릿을 선택합니다. .
  3. 여기에 Windows 구성 요소 폴더가 표시됩니다. . 클릭하고 Windows Defender를 선택합니다. .

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. 여기에서 다양한 옵션을 찾을 수 있습니다. 이들을 탐색하고 "Windows Defender 끄기를 선택합니다. ".

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

  1. '사용 선택 "를 눌러 Windows Defender를 끕니다. 설정을 적용하고 확인을 누릅니다.

수정:원격 프로시저 호출 높은 CPU 및 디스크 사용량

위의 단계를 완료하면 Windows Defender가 꺼집니다. 컴퓨터를 다시 시작하고 디스크/CPU 사용량이 수정되었는지 확인합니다.